Как считать фотографии на моей стене FANPAGE? - PullRequest
0 голосов
/ 13 января 2012

Я дал фанатам возможность загружать фотографии на стену FANPAGE.Как я могу посчитать опубликованные фотографии?Я слишком молод в FB.apis :-( Спасибо!

Ответы [ 2 ]

1 голос
/ 14 января 2012

Я только что прочитал http://developers.facebook.com/docs/reference/api/photo/

Отдельная фотография, представленная в Graph API.

Чтобы прочитать объект 'photo', вам нужно

любой действительный маркер access_token, если он общедоступный
разрешение user_photos для доступа к фотографиям и альбомам, загруженным пользователем, и фотографиям, на которых пользователь был отмечен
разрешение friends_photos для доступа к фотографиям друзей и фотографиям, на которых есть друзья пользователябыло помечено
Чтобы опубликовать объект 'photo', вам нужен

действительный токен доступа
разрешение publish_stream
Получив это разрешение, вы можете загрузить фотографию, отправив запрос HTTP POST с фотографиейсодержимое и необязательное описание для этих подключений к Graph API:

https://graph.facebook.com/USER_ID/photos - фотография будет опубликована в альбом, созданный для вашего приложения.Мы автоматически создаем альбом для вашего приложения, если он еще не существует.Все фотографии, загруженные таким образом, будут добавлены в этот же альбом.

https://graph.facebook.com/ALBUM_ID/photos - фотография будет опубликована в конкретный существующий фотоальбом, представленный ALBUM_ID.Обычные альбомы имеют ограничение в размере 200 фотографий.Альбомы приложений по умолчанию имеют ограничение по размеру 1000 фотографий.

PAGE или APP создают СОБСТВЕННЫЙ XLBUM, который может иметь такой же доступ: https://graph.facebook.com/ALBUM_ID/photos

Но есть 1000 фотографийограничение!

0 голосов
/ 13 января 2012

С помощью API Graph вы можете отключить подключение Photos к объекту Page.

См .: http://developers.facebook.com/docs/reference/api/page/

Вы можете поиграть здесь: http://developers.facebook.com/tools/explorer

  1. Получить /me/accounts
  2. Нажмите на один из идентификаторов страницы, на котором есть несколько фотографий.
  3. Добавить / фото после идентификатора страницы и нажать кнопку Получить /{pageId}/photos
...